WHAT ABOUT VISA FOR TANZANIA?

When it comes to a visa for Tanzania, these are some of the things you need to be aware of.

Make sure, as a guest, that passports and visas are valid for your Tanzanian visit. The Tanzanian authorities have upgraded their visa application process so you can apply online. The visa is called an eTA, which grants you a visa in your passport on arrival.

Guests from certain countries can apply for a visa on arrival (Visa at the airport takes between 5-30 minutes, depending on the number of arrivals). You can apply online via the e-visa service at https://eservices.immigration.go.tz/. (processing may take up to 72 hours)

You can check the visa rules before you apply on this page: https://visa.immigration.go.tz/guidelines.

If you choose to get the visa on arrival, it is possible at any Tanzanian International Airport or border crossing.

For a tourism visa, the fee is 50, – USD, except for Americans, where the visa fee is 100, – USD. (other benefits for American visa holders)

ADDITIONAL VISA INFORMATION

Do not use foreign companies to get your visa. You are advised to make your applications through the Official Tanzania Immigration Services website (https://eservices.immigration.go.tz/) ONLY and NOT through any other online links.

Passports should have at least six months of validity after the final day of travel.
